Transaction 80fcaf5c2ba887da4dae344e4ec017131bd897f22f3a4d6b0cc0d58ef9f07331
1 Input
1 Outputs
- 80fcaf5c2ba887da4dae344e4ec017131bd897f22f3a4d6b0cc0d58ef9f07331:0
value 55233
address 3Jpj5WPdmJU7463SgRFggCjAizm6yMkRLb